Overview

In the Bávaro region of Punta Cana, Dominican Republic, Bávaro Adventure Park offers a lively mix of thrills, from zip lines that cut through the warm breeze to winding trails under the palm trees, on top of that from zip-lining through palm-lined valleys to exploring local markets rich with the scent of fresh mango, it packs in outdoor adventures for every age, drawing families, thrill-seekers, and anyone eager to soak up the Dominican Republic’s natural beauty and vibrant culture in a lively, hands-on way.First, as a result bávaro Adventure Park sits in the heart of Bávaro, a lively spot in the Punta Cana region where palm trees sway in the warm breeze.That means you can reach it quickly from nearly all the big resorts in the area, whether you’re staying in Bávaro, Punta Cana, or Cap Cana, to boot bávaro Adventure Park sits just a 25–30 minute drive from Punta Cana International Airport, so it’s an easy trip for arriving travelers, generally Many nearby resorts run shuttles or include transport in their packages, making the ride as simple as stepping into an air‑conditioned van, in conjunction with once there, you’ll find everything from heart‑pounding zip lines to quiet nature trails-plenty to suit thrill‑seekers and those who’d rather take it slow.Zip Line: The park’s zip line is a must-try, letting you glide between emerald treetops and catch flashes of turquoise sea far below, what’s more the zip line course welcomes both first-timers and seasoned thrill-seekers, while the park’s ATV tours rumble across the rocky trails and sun‑baked hills of the Dominican countryside, in some ways Believe it or not, You can wind along dirt trails by car, weave through shady forests, and spot deer or bright-winged birds, all with the rush of the ride in your chest, subsequently if you’d rather slow down, saddle up for a horseback ride-a favorite way to take in the park’s quiet beauty.Frankly, You can wander on horseback along winding, sun-dappled trails, taking in the lush green hills at your own pace, equally important if you’re chasing a rush, step to the edge and feel your heart hammer before a bungee jump sends you plunging into open air.At Bávaro Adventure Park, you can step off a high platform for a bungee jump, feeling the rush of wind on your face before the cord snaps you safely back, then if you’re into team play, grab a paintball gun and duck behind trees on the park’s rugged forest course.Test your grit on the obstacle course, scaling walls, swinging on ropes, and pushing your endurance, also or head underground on a guided cave tour, lantern in hand, to witness ancient rock formations and learn their story.All of it unfolds in a lush tropical setting alive with birdsong and the scent of warm earth, therefore tropical Landscape: Dense forests ring the park, with quiet lagoons tucked between the trees and other wild touches that make every step outside feel like an adventure.Mind you, Set against lush greenery, many activities invite participants to soak in the Dominican Republic’s natural beauty, at the same time as they wander the park’s trails, they might spot flashes of bright tropical birds, quick darting lizards, and other native creatures.At the park, you can hike shaded trails or zip past palms, getting close to nature while treating it with care, to boot bávaro Adventure Park backs that up with eco-friendly practices and a steady commitment to protecting the environment.The park works hard to keep its ecological footprint small, from sorting waste to encouraging visitors to choose eco‑friendly habits, consequently and while thrill‑seekers can race down zip lines or tackle steep trails, families will also find gentle hikes, playgrounds shaded by tall pines, and activities perfect for kids.Kids can try a smaller zip line built just for them, zipping over soft grass under watchful eyes, furthermore families can hop on guided ATV tours, ride horseback along shaded trails, or wander quiet paths through the trees.For a deeper connection, join hands-on cultural activities and hear stories that bring the Dominican Republic’s history and traditions to life, besides you’ll find lively showcases of local music, energetic dancing, and hands-on traditional crafts, turning the visit into a rich learning experience for kids and adults alike.When you’re ready to eat, Bávaro Adventure Park offers several spots to grab a meal or a cold drink and relax, alternatively whether you want a quick bite or a hearty meal, the park’s got you covered with on-site spots to eat and drink, including a restaurant serving Dominican favorites like smoky grilled meats, rice and beans, and slices of sweet, chilled mango.You’ll find bars pouring icy cocktails and chilled drinks-perfect after a day of zip-lining or hiking-along with shady picnic spots where you can unpack your own lunch and eat surrounded by rustling leaves; Bávaro Adventure Park also offers tour packages that bundle several activities into one visit, along with some of the park’s most sought‑after options include Adventure Packages packed with activities like zip‑lining through the treetops, ATV rides that kick up clouds of dust, and horseback treks along scenic trails.For an upgraded visit, VIP Packages offer skip‑the‑line access, a private guide, and exclusive perks for a smooth, made‑just‑for‑you experience, simultaneously many tour operators also provide transportation from popular resorts in Punta Cana and Bávaro, so getting to the park is effortless, roughly At Bávaro Adventure Park, safety comes first-every harness, helmet, and piece of gear is inspected and maintained to meet the highest standards, along with trained guides lead every activity, keeping a close eye on safety-like making sure helmets are snug before you set off.Staff walk you through each activity with clear, safety-first guidance, making sure everyone feels at ease from start to finish, likewise the park relies on top-notch gear-think gleaming zip-line cables, sturdy ATVs, and flawless bungee cords-so every thrill comes with peace of mind.It’s a perfect spot for groups.
